Partager via


Structure PosBarcodeScannerDataReceivedEventData (pointofservicedriverinterface.h)

Cette structure contient les données analysées transmises à l’événement BarcodeScannerDataReceived.

Syntaxe

typedef struct _PosBarcodeScannerDataReceivedEventData {
  PosEventDataHeader Header;
  UINT32             DataType;
  UINT32             ScanDataLength;
  UINT32             ScanDataLabelLength;
} PosBarcodeScannerDataReceivedEventData;

Membres

Header

Les informations d’en-tête PosEventDataHeader pour cet événement.

DataType

Indique quel code-barres est associé aux données d’analyse.

ScanDataLength

Indique le nombre d’octets de données analysées brutes.

ScanDataLabelLength

Indique le nombre d’octets de données d’analyse décodées. Une étiquette est les données d’analyse décodées dans lesquelles les informations d’en-tête et de pied de page ont été supprimées, en laissant uniquement les données brutes du scanneur.

Remarques

ScanDataLength octets de données d’analyse suit immédiatement la structure PosBarcodeScannerDataReceivedEventData, suivie de ScanDataLabelLength octets de données d’étiquette.

Exigences

Exigence Valeur
d’en-tête pointofservicedriverinterface.h (include PointOfServiceDriverInterface.h)